What smell will keep rats away?

You can repel rats from your home and garden with scents they dislike, such as clover, garlic, onion, hot peppers containing capsaicin, house ammonia, used coffee grounds, peppermint, eucalyptus, predator (cat) scent, white vinegar, and citronella oil.

What can I put in my garden to get rid of rats?

Planting garlic in a few places in your garden will keep them at bay. It will also keep fleas and ticks away as well. Black pepper, cayenne, sage and oregano are also known to repel rodents. Planting or sprinkling them around the edges of your garden can be an effective way to keep rats away.

Do rats come out during the day?

Rats may also be more likely to come out during the day when they are accustomed to being around humans. However, rats are generally more nocturnal because they are more difficult to spot by predators, such as hawks and other birds of prey at night. It’s not unusual to see rats during the daytime.

Does dog poop attract rats?

Dog poop attracts rodents.

“Dog waste is often a leading food source for rats in urban areas,” D’Aniello says. Although it is good that the waste is being eaten, it’s definitely not ideal that dog poop that isn’t picked up will likely attract both rats and mice, D’Aniello says.

How do you repel rats outside?

Keep tall grass, bushes, shrubs and mulch away from building foundations. Pull out ivy around burrows. Keep ground bare six inches from buildings, and trim under shrubs. Make space between plants and avoid dense planting.
